Trade Secretary meets Cypriot community

  • Tweet
Monday, 19 June, 2023
  • Articles

Theresa Villiers, MP for Chipping Barnet, has introduced members of the Cypriot community to the Rt Hon Kemi Badenoch, Secretary of State for Business and President of the Board of Trade.

The meeting took place at a Conservative event last week hosted by Theresa Villiers at the prestigious Travellers Club in Pall Mall.

Mrs Badenoch spoke about the opportunities that international trade liberalisation offers to businesses in the UK and Cyprus.

Those attending the function included photographer and reporter, Doros Partasides; Antonis Savvides, Elias Dinenis, Yiannis Stergides from the Board of British Cypriots; Theo Theodorou from Lobby for Cyprus; George Hadjipavlis, from Conservatives Friends of Cyprus; Andreas Papaevripides, President of the World Federation of Cypriots; and Andre Chris, President of the Enfield Southgate Conservative Association.

Speaking afterwards, Theresa said “I was delighted to be able to bring members of the Cypriot community together to meet Kemi Badenoch. She is a rising star of the Conservative Party and it was good for her to hear from British Cypriots about issues that matter to them.”

“I am always keen to encourage trade and business links between Cyprus and the UK,” Theresa continued. “It was great that the Trade Secretary heard at first hand about the success of British Cypriot businesses.”

Mrs Badenoch was formally presented with the book by Doros Partasides “Faces of Cyprus”. Copies of this collection of photos have been presented to many Ministers and famous figures over the years.

During the presentation Doros Partasides said to the Secretary of State that he hoped the book would help her get to know Cypriots and inspire her to get involved in efforts to reunite Cyprus.
